Does Kamala Harris Have Cats? 2025 Facts & Info

Kamala Harris’ name has been spreading like wildfire as she is the 2024 presidential candidate for the Democratic Party. People are eager to learn more about her as they decide on which candidate will receive their vote. Word has been circulating that Kamala Harris is a cat lady, which can be an added bonus for voters who are fellow cat parents and pet owners. However, Kamala Harris doesn’t actually have any cats.

Despite not having pet cats, Kamala Harris is still an animal lover who has endorsed and helped pass pro-animal legislation. Her history with animal welfare and climate change policies often aligns with animal rights activists and advocates.

Why Do People Think Kamala Harris Has Cats?

Kamala Harris has been associated with being a cat lady after a 2021 interview from Donald Trump’s vice-presidential pick JD Vance resurfaced. In this interview, JD Vance commented that the Democratic Party had “childless cat ladies” trying to make decisions for the entire country.1

JD Vance’s comment was meant to discredit the Democratic Party. However, Kamala Harris and the rest of the Democratic Party moved to reclaim the term “cat lady” and changed it to have a positive and empowering meaning.

Does Kamala Harris Have Any Pets?

While Kamala Harris currently doesn’t have any pets, she has received massive support from cat ladies. In fact, a cat lady-themed rally was organized recently and took place on August 4, 2024. Over 21,000 invitees across the country attended the Cat Ladies for Kamala Zoom call to show their support and raise funds for Kamala Harris’ campaign.

What Is Kamala Harris’ Stance on Animal Rights Issues?

Even though Kamala Harris doesn’t have any pets, she’s no stranger to animal rights and supporting animal welfare. During her 2016 US Senate campaign, one of her platform pledges was “Fight for Nationwide Protections for Animal Rights.”

During her time in the Senate, Kamala Harris consistently achieved a score of 100 out of 100 on the Humane Society’s Humane Scorecard. Here are just a few notable policies that Kamala Harris pushed for and supported throughout her political career.

California Animal Protection Laws

When Kamala Harris was the Attorney General of California, she supported various pro-animal rights legislation. She defended the ban on the sale of foie gras in California due to the inhumane practices surrounding the production of foie gras. She supported the ban of the possession and sale of shark fins in California.

Kamala Harris was also a pioneer in pushing Proposition 2 and AB 1437. Proposition 2 refers to the prohibition of keeping egg-laying hens in battery cages, and it was in favor of California voters in 2008. AB 1437 is legislation that bans selling eggs produced by hens in battery cages in California.

Help Extract Animals from Red Tape (HEART) Act

The HEART Act was introduced by Kamala Harris and Senator Susan Collins to help abused animals of animal fights and gambling. This bipartisan legislation was designed to hold offenders accountable by making them financially responsible for the care of the animals seized from federal animal fighting cases. It would speed up the disposition process for federally seized animals to reduce the amount of time it takes for them to be placed in humane care.

Horseracing Integrity & Safety Act

The Horseracing Integrity & Safety Act was passed in December 2020. This act made race day horse drugging illegal, and it formed the Horseracing Integrity & Safety Authority (HISA). HISA’s main responsibilities include regulating and enforcing racetrack safety and developing and administering anti-doping and medication rules.

Big Cat Public Safety Act

Even though she’s not a cat owner, Kamala Harris can still be considered a cat lady due to her active involvement with the Big Cat Public Safety Act. This act was enacted in December 2022. It protects big cats by prohibiting the private ownership and breeding of big cats. It also protects people by making it illegal for exhibitors to allow people to have direct contact with big cat cubs.

Conclusion

Considering the weight of responsibilities that government leaders have, we’re not surprised that Kamala Harris doesn’t have any pets. However, we can be reassured that she cares for animal welfare due to her strong track record of supporting pro-animal legislation. She’s an animal lover, and she fights for policies that protect their rights and promote humane care and conditions for all kinds of animals.
